#Qatargate: What are the consequences for the EU

The World

A European lawmaker is due to appear in court on Thursday, charged with corruption in one of the biggest scandals involving the European Parliament in decades. Greek MEP Eva Kaili is accused of allegedly accepting large sums of money to lobby in favor of Qatar. Some lawmakers worry that the allegations could have far-reaching consequences for the EU project itself. The World’s Europe correspondent Orla Barry reports.
